Key Strategies to Leverage Cybersecurity Awareness Month October 2025 for Your Business

1. Launch a Comprehensive Security Awareness Campaign

Start by designing a targeted campaign that educates employees about cybersecurity best practices. Use engaging content such as interactive quizzes, videos, and infographics to make the learning process engaging. Focus on topics like recognizing phishing scams, securing passwords, and safeguarding mobile devices.

2. Conduct Security Assessments and Vulnerability Scans

This period is an ideal window to perform internal and external security assessments. Engage cybersecurity experts to identify potential vulnerabilities within your network, applications, and infrastructure. Address weaknesses promptly to reduce the risk of exploitation.

3. Update and Enforce Security Policies

Review existing policies related to data handling, access controls, incident response, and remote working. Ensure they align with the latest standards and best practices. Communicate these policies clearly across your organization and enforce strict adherence.

4. Invest in Employee Training and Simulated Attacks

Run simulated phishing campaigns and tabletop exercises to assess employee readiness. Offer ongoing training programs tailored for different roles within your organization. Cultivating a security-aware workforce minimizes the likelihood of successful cyberattacks.

5. Implement Advanced Cybersecurity Technologies

Best Practices for Maintaining a Robust Security Posture

  • Regular Employee Training: Schedule ongoing education sessions and refreshers.
  • Routine Security Audits: Conduct bi-annual evaluations of system security measures.
  • Strong Password Policies: Enforce complex, unique passwords and MFA on all accounts.
  • Data Encryption & Backup: Encrypt sensitive data and maintain off-site backups for disaster recovery.
  • Stay Informed: Subscribe to cybersecurity news, threat intelligence reports, and industry updates.
